“…Due to the complicated interactions between the river and sea and the water chemical condition (such as variations in pH and redox potential) in estuaries, some metals, such as iron (Fe), manganese (Mn), cobalt (Co), cadmium (Cd), copper (Cu) and zinc (Zn), might frequently undergo deposition and resuspension at the interface of sediment and water (Fan et al 2009;Stockdale et al 2010;Sakellari et al 2011). This phenomenon is similar to a ''time bomb'' for estuaries (Gao et al 2006;Feng et al 2011). Increasing human activities, such as industry and shipping, have greatly amplified this stress.…”
